forentity map参数-概述说明以及解释
1.引言
1.1 概述
在本文中,我们将重点介绍使用RestTemplate的getForEntity方法中的map参数。RestTemplate是Spring框架提供的一个强大的HTTP客户端工具,用于发送HTTP请求并处理响应。其中,getForEntity方法是RestTemplate提供的一种常用的GET请求方法,它允许我们发送GET请求并返回一个包含响应体、响应头和响应状态码的ResponseEntity对象。
在使用getForEntity方法时,我们可以不仅可以传递URL和HTTP请求头作为参数,还可以传递一个map参数用于替换URL中的变量。这意味着我们可以在URL中定义变量,并通过map参数将其动态地替换为实际的值。这样一来,我们可以轻松地构建出具有动态变量的URL,从而实现更加灵活和可定制化的请求。
本文中,我们将深入研究getForEntity方法的map参数的使用方式和特点。我们将探讨如何在URL中定义变量,并在map参数中传递对应的值。我们还将讨论map参数的一些高级用法,例
如对URL编码的支持以及如何传递带有特殊字符的值。
通过学习和理解getForEntity方法的map参数,我们将能够更加灵活地使用RestTemplate发送GET请求,并在URL中动态地传递参数。无论是对于简单的RESTful API还是复杂的请求场景,getForEntity方法的map参数都能够帮助我们轻松应对,并提升开发效率。
接下来,我们将详细介绍RestTemplate的getForEntity方法以及它的map参数的使用,帮助读者全面了解和掌握这一功能。在正文中,我们将深入探讨getForEntity方法的各种使用场景,并提供实际的代码示例和解释。最后,我们将总结RestTemplate的使用,并对getForEntity方法的map参数进行详细总结和归纳。留下具体问题的读者可以参考文章的结论部分,以获取更详细和具体的信息。
本文旨在帮助读者充分理解和掌握RestTemplate的getForEntity方法中map参数的使用,从而能够更加灵活和高效地进行HTTP请求。无论是初学者还是有经验的开发者,都可以通过本文获得有关getForEntity方法的map参数的宝贵知识。希望本文对您有所帮助,并能激发您进一步研究和应用RestTemplate的兴趣和能力。
1.2 文章结构
本文将围绕RestTemplate的getForEntity方法的map参数展开讨论。首先,将通过引言部分对整篇文章进行概述和目的的说明。接着,正文部分将分为两个小节,分别介绍RestTemplate的简介和getForEntity方法的详细介绍。在RestTemplate简介中,将介绍RestTemplate的概念和作用,为读者提供一个整体的了解。而在getForEntity方法的介绍中,将详细解释该方法的使用方式、参数含义和常见应用场景。最后,在结论部分,将对整篇文章进行总结,并对getForEntity方法的map参数进行深入总结和分析。
通过以上文章结构的安排,旨在逐步引导读者了解和掌握RestTemplate的getForEntity方法的map参数的使用方式和应用场景。从整体上讲,本文将从引言、正文和结论三个部分来逐步展开讲解,使读者能够逐步深入理解和掌握相关知识。在整个文章结构中,每一个部分都扮演着重要的角,有助于读者系统地了解和学习getForEntity方法的map参数。
文章1.3 目的
目的部分旨在阐明本文的写作目的和意图,为读者提供文章撰写的背景和重要性。本文的目的是探讨RestTemplate中的getForEntity方法以及其map参数的使用。
RestTemplate是Spring框架中的一个核心类,用于发送HTTP请求并接收响应。它提供了一种方便的方式来与REST风格的Web服务进行交互。getForEntity方法是RestTemplate提供的一个常用方法,可用于发送GET请求并返回响应实体。
本文的目的是通过深入研究RestTemplate的getForEntity方法和其map参数,帮助读者更好地理解和掌握该方法的使用。通过具体的示例和解释,我们将介绍如何使用getForEntity方法发送GET请求,并使用map参数传递请求参数。我们还将讨论map参数的常见用法和注意事项,以及如何处理响应实体。
通过阅读本文,读者将能够了解RestTemplate的基本概念和使用方式,特别是getForEntity方法的使用。同时,他们将学习如何正确使用map参数来定制GET请求,并获得所需的响应结果。本文旨在为读者提供一个全面而详细的指南,帮助他们在实际项目中更好地使用RestTemplate。
总之,本文的目的是为读者提供关于RestTemplate的getForEntity方法和其map参数的详细信息,帮助他们掌握这一强大的HTTP请求方法,并在实际项目中能够灵活应用。通过阅读本文,读者将能够更加自信地使用RestTemplate进行RESTful Web服务的交互。
逗号分割的字符串转数组
2.正文
2.1 RestTemplate简介
RestTemplate是Spring框架提供的一个用于发送HTTP请求的客户端工具,它提供了便捷的方法来访问和操作RESTful风格的Web服务。
RestTemplate可以发送HTTP的GET、POST、PUT、DELETE等类型的请求,并且支持自定义请求头、请求体和URI参数。它还具有丰富的方法来处理服务器响应,包括将响应体映射为Java对象、处理二进制数据和处理错误状态码等。
使用RestTemplate可以简化与Web服务的交互,无需手动创建HTTP连接和解析响应。它封装了底层的HTTP通信细节,使得开发者可以更专注于业务逻辑的实现。
RestTemplate内部使用了HttpClient或HttpURLConnection等HTTP库来发送请求,具备了较高的性能和稳定性。它还支持连接池和异步请求,方便应对高并发场景的需求。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。